Sequencing Pictures

By SEN Resource Source

Sequencing pictures for children to cut out and order of events.

Why do you need this?

Sequencing pictures can help children understand the chronological order of events in a story or narrative. Teachers can use them to reinforce storytelling skills and support comprehension.

Working with sequencing pictures encourages critical thinking as children analyze the sequence of events and identify the correct order. It promotes problem-solving and decision-making skills.

Sequencing activities promote language development by encouraging children to describe the events depicted in the pictures. It provides opportunities for vocabulary expansion and oral language practice.

How and when might you use this?

This activity could be used in a variety of ways such as:

· Early learning centers

· Small group instruction to provide targeted support

· Speech and language support

· Independent work stations

For continued use I would recommend laminating this resource and using Velcro to move the jigsaw pieces around.

HOW TO USE:

To prepare, print out, cut and laminate the cards (or print them on a heavier stock paper).

To be played in groups of 2 to 6 students.

There are two versions how to play the game:

VERSION 1

  • All the cards are in a pile in the center, picture up. Each player gets one card, picture down. They all flip their card at the same time. The first player to find a match between his/her card and the card on the top of the pile and say the word out loud, wins the card. They place it on top of their pile.

VERSION 2

  • There is one card in the center, picture up. Each player gets an equal number of cards, they keep them in a pile. The first player to find a match between the card in the center and the card on top of their pile gets to place their card on the card in the center.
